As the curtain falls on the acclaimed Korean drama series Shin Byeong 3, writer Yoon Gi-Young reflects on its remarkable journey. In an engaging interview at a cozy café in Samcheong-dong, Jongno-gu, Seoul, Yoon and director Min Jin-Ki discuss the challenges they faced. Yoon highlights the pressure from audience expectations but maintains a strong passion for storytelling. This passion stems from the captivating characters that populate the series. He aimed to showcase the growth of these characters while preserving their core characteristics.
One standout character is Major Jo Baek-ho, played by Oh Dae-Hwan. Yoon views Jo not just as a military leader but as an ideal figure for any organization. He praises Oh’s portrayal, which adds depth and authenticity to the role. The plot of Shin Byeong 3 unfolds with unpredictable twists. It introduces new recruits like Kim Dong-Jun and Moon Bit-Na-Ri while bringing back the formidable antagonist Seong Yoon-Mo. Central to the story is Park Min-Seok, who faces personal challenges as he approaches his promotion to Corporal, all within the context of military life.
The final episode aired on the 29th, achieving a peak viewership rating of 3.3%, according to Nielsen Korea. This milestone reflects the hard work of the cast and crew and resonates with the audience’s connection to the characters.
